[0021] A kind of cultivation method of salamander of the present invention, comprises the following steps:

[0022] (1) For the pond, build a cave with marble in advance and place aquatic plants for the giant salamander to hide. It can be cultivated indoors and outdoors. The outdoor is a specially built breeding pond in the open air, and the indoor is a breeding pond transformed from various idle facilities. Abstract

The invention discloses a giant salamander breeding method. The giant salamander breeding method involves a pond, fish fry, the breeding water temperature, baby giant salamander breeding, young giant salamander breeding, adult giant salamander breeding, large giant salamander breeding, the feeding frequency, giant salamander diseases and the fish fry growth cycle. The giant salamander breeding method is wide in application range, the situations of breeding of giant salamanders in different stages are adjusted in time, the quality of the fish fry is high, and the survival rate of the giant salamanders is increased.

technical field [0001] The invention relates to the field of breeding methods, in particular to a method for breeding salamanders. Background technique [0002] Giant salamander is the largest and most precious amphibian in the world. Its cry is very similar to the cry of a child, so people also call it "baby fish". 1 meter and above, the heaviest one can exceed 100 catties, and its shape is somewhat similar to a lizard, but it is fatter and flatter in comparison. Salamanders breathe with gills when they are young, and breathe with lungs when they grow up. Giant salamanders inhabit streams in mountainous areas, and live in caves with clear water, low sand content, turbulent water flow, and backflow water. The front part is flat, and the tail gradually becomes side flat. There are obvious skin folds on both sides of the body. The limbs are short and flat.
